We can control the time during the day by determining activities that will be done and the times they will be carried out.
The lack of control of time is directly associated with the lack of organization of an individual about their activities and the time in which each of them will be established.
For this reason, to control time, the individual must organize his activities, determining how many minutes and hours will be spent on each activity.
In addition to the organization, the individual must buy the time limits that he has established, allowing a greater sense of the passage of hours and optimizing the daytime period.
